A.G. Loukianov is a leading researcher in nonlinear control systems and geometric algebra, with a particular focus on robust control for robotic manipulators. His most-cited work, "Robust Pose Control of Robot Manipulators Using Conformal Geometric Algebra" (2014, 23 citations), introduces an innovative framework that leverages conformal geometric algebra to unify position and orientation control in a single, mathematically elegant representation. This approach significantly enhances robustness against uncertainties and disturbances, offering a powerful alternative to traditional methods.
